CAUTION: Tank and tank compo-
nents should be delimed regularly
depending on local water conditions.
Excessive mineral build-up on stain-
less steel surfaces can initiate cor-
rosive reactions resulting in serious
leaks.

Check the operating water pressure
to the brewer. It must be between
20 and 90 psi (138 and 620 kPa).
Water should flow freely from the
sprayhead for approximately twenty
seconds after the brew solenoid has
shut-off and then stop flowing
abruptly. The brewer must be level
from front-to-back to syphon prop-
erly.
Adjust the brew timer as required to
achieve the recommended 64 oz for
each brew cycle.
